* A typical caller instantiates this class and starts the login process. * The caller then obtains an array of Callback objects, * which contains the information required by the authentication plug-in * module. The caller requests information from the user. On receiving * the information from the user, the caller submits the same to this class. * If more information is required, the above process continues until all * the information required by the plug-ins/authentication modules, has * been supplied. The caller then checks if the user has successfully * been authenticated. If successfully authenticated, the caller can * then get the Subject and SSOToken for the user; * if not successfully authenticated, the caller obtains the AuthLoginException. *

* The implementation supports authenticating users either locally * i.e., in process with all authentication modules configured or remotely * to an authentication service/framework. (See documentation to configure * in either of the modes). *

* The getRequirements() and submitRequirements() * are used to pass the user credentials for authentication by the plugin * modules,getStatus() returns the authentication status. *
